## Architecture Overview

Arivu consists of three main deployable components:

<Columns cols={3}>
  <Card title="Backend API" icon="server">
    FastAPI/Uvicorn server running the pipeline and integrations
  </Card>

  <Card title="Frontend Dashboard" icon="layout-grid">
    Next.js React application for visualization and management
  </Card>

  <Card title="Supporting Services" icon="database">
    Memory backend (Redis/SQLite), database connectors, LLM clients
  </Card>

## Key Considerations

<AccordionGroup>
  <Accordion title="Scalability" defaultOpen icon="trending-up">
    * **Backend**: Horizontal scaling with load balancing
    * **Frontend**: CDN distribution for static assets
    * **Database**: Connection pooling and replication
    * **Memory**: Redis cluster for distributed state
  </Accordion>

  <Accordion title="Performance" icon="zap">
    * **Latency**: Deploy close to users and databases
    * **Caching**: Browser cache + Redis for query results
    * **Async**: FastAPI async operations for concurrency
    * **Optimization**: Image compression, code splitting
  </Accordion>

  <Accordion title="Security" icon="shield">
    * **API Keys**: Secure storage in secrets manager
    * **Database credentials**: Never in code
    * **TLS/HTTPS**: Enforce across all communications
    * **RBAC**: Role-based access control
    * **Network isolation**: Private VPCs, security groups
  </Accordion>

  <Accordion title="Cost Optimization" icon="dollar-sign">
    * **Compute**: Right-size instances, use spot/preemptible VMs
    * **Storage**: Use managed services where available
    * **Data transfer**: Minimize cross-region traffic
    * **Monitoring**: Pay-per-use or reserved capacity
  </Accordion>

  <Accordion title="Reliability" icon="shield-check">
    * **HA**: Multi-AZ deployments
    * **Backup**: Automated database backups
    * **Failover**: Health checks and auto-recovery
    * **Monitoring**: Real-time alerting
  </Accordion>

## Recommended Platforms

| Platform                      | Best For                           | Complexity | Cost   |
| ----------------------------- | ---------------------------------- | ---------- | ------ |
| **AWS ECS**                   | Most flexible, largest ecosystem   | Medium     | \$\$\$ |
| **AWS EKS**                   | Kubernetes-first, multi-cloud      | High       | \$\$\$ |
| **Azure App Service**         | Quick deployment, integrated tools | Low        | \$\$   |
| **Azure Container Instances** | Simple containerized apps          | Low        | \$\$   |
| **DigitalOcean App Platform** | Simplicity, affordability          | Low        | \$     |
| **Vercel**                    | Frontend only, zero-config         | Very Low   | \$     |
| **Heroku**                    | Rapid prototyping                  | Very Low   | \$\$   |
